Transaction 77c8f64e19e42ad726980cdb1c02f73a03a2fba907f02636d1c28f3d0ab8f99f

2 Input
2 Outputs
  • 77c8f64e19e42ad726980cdb1c02f73a03a2fba907f02636d1c28f3d0ab8f99f:0
  • value  1010525
    address  36hMr13PWS4y74pd4e3qmgAKV4ifnR9odT
  • 77c8f64e19e42ad726980cdb1c02f73a03a2fba907f02636d1c28f3d0ab8f99f:1
  • value  258847
    address  16V7fRWQArYYkawYcueQqZSjDDEmggGiT6